Construction Site Fire Hazards and Controls
Fires are among the most common and serious hazards associated with construction operations, and they can potentially cause major property losses and fatalities. To control this hazard, construction managers, general contractors, and subcontractors should have programs and procedures in place to help limit the potential for fires.
The following information covers typical fire hazards found on construction sites and the precautions that can be taken to help control them.
Fire Extinguishers
Fire extinguishers are typically the first line of defense for combating fires. They are classified by the type of fuel that is burning and the media necessary to extinguish it.
Class A fires involve ordinary combustible materials such as wood, paper, rags, and rubbish.
Class B fires involve vapor-air mixtures from flammable liquids such as gasoline, oil, grease, paints, and thinners.
Class C fires involve energized electrical equipment.
Class D fires involve combustible metals such as magnesium, titanium, potassium, and sodium.
A multi-purpose Class A, B, C fire extinguisher is appropriate for many construction sites. This type of extinguisher is effective at controlling all three types of fires typically found on construction sites: general combustibles, flammable liquids, and electrical sources.
Many contractors supply fire extinguishers on projects and falsely assume that employees know how to use them. Contact your local fire department or fire extinguisher supplier to conduct fire extinguisher training.
Fire extinguishers must be kept in good working condition. Regular inspections and tests, as well as preventive maintenance, are important to help ensure fire extinguishers function properly.
Fire extinguisher requirements are contained in the applicable OSHA standards. (see references)
Housekeeping
Poor housekeeping contributes to fire hazards on many construction sites. A small fire can quickly spread to piles of scrap or waste materials.
All combustible refuse (scrap materials, packaging, and wastepaper) should be removed regularly.
All waste piles or dumpsters should be located in areas away from potential ignition sources. Do not expose waste piles or dumpsters to overhead welding or cutting.
Welding and Cutting
Every construction manager, general contractor, subcontractor overseeing or completing hot work should develop a formal, written hot work permit program. This program should include, at minimum; notifying the fire department that hot work is being performed, removing all combustibles from the hot work area, and having suitable fire extinguishing equipment in the work area. In addition, there should be a 1-hour fire watch after completing the hot work. The hot work permit program should conform to NFPA 51B, Standard for Fire Prevention during Welding, Cutting, and Other Hot Work.

Compressed Gas Cylinders
Oxygen and fuel-gas cylinders in storage should be separated by a minimum distance of 20 feet (6 meters) or separated by a 5-foot (1.5 meter) high barrier of noncombustible material. When not in use, valve protection caps should be placed over cylinder valves to prevent accidental valve damage or displacement.
Because of the extreme flammability of liquid petroleum gas, it should never be stored inside a building.
Oil and grease in the presence of pure oxygen can burn with explosive force if ignited. Never use these materials around pure oxygen.
Because compressed gases are extremely flammable and explosive, only trained, qualified and authorized personnel should be permitted to handle them.
Cut-off Saws
Sparks produced by cut-off saws can ignite nearby combustible materials. All combustible materials should be removed from the area or protected from sparks. A fire extinguisher should be readily available, and a fire watch should be posted at the work site for at least 1-hour after the work is completed.
Flammable and Combustible (Ignitable) Liquids
Flammable and combustible liquids used on construction sites require specific controls and safeguards. Storage of Class I and Class II liquids should not exceed 60 gallons (227 liters) within 50 feet (15 meters) of the building. Open flames and smoking should not be allowed in flammable and combustible liquid storage areas. Class I and Class II liquids should be stored in approved containers. A fire extinguisher is required on all service/fueling trucks.
Fuel storage and handling areas should be:
- Located away from all fire exposures
- Free from accumulated debris or undergrowth
- Properly grounded and bonded
- Posted with "no smoking" signs
- Equipped with appropriate fire extinguishers
Use approved safety cans for storing and dispensing small quantities of flammable liquids. The flash-arresting screens inside safety cans should not be removed. The screens are designed to keep any ignition source from igniting the vapors inside the can.
Refer to NFPA 30, Flammable and Combustible Liquids Code, for additional guidance.
Temporary Electrical Equipment
Only qualified personnel should perform electrical installations and repairs.
Conductors must not rest on floors or be installed in a manner that will subject them to physical damage. They should also be of sufficient current-carrying capacity to supply the demand and should be equipped with over-current protection.
Ample electrical outlets should be provided throughout the work area to eliminate the need for excessively long or overloaded extension cords.
Electrical cords and equipment should be periodically inspected. Damaged or worn equipment or cords should be taken out of service and repaired or replaced. Equipment should be connected to a ground fault circuit interrupter (GFCI). Essentially, all electrical wiring and equipment for lighting, heating or power purposes should comply with NFPA 70, National Electrical Code.
Light bulbs used in temporary lighting systems should be equipped with protective baskets to help prevent contact with combustible materials. Lighting systems should be properly secured to prevent accidental displacement of the fixtures to, prevent igniting combustibles.
Temporary Heating Equipment
The use of temporary heaters causes a number of fires every year. When using temporary heaters, it is important to remember to keep all combustibles away from the heaters. Heaters should not be left unattended. The heaters also should be approved for the particular use. Temporary heating equipment should be monitored for safe operation and maintained by trained personnel.
All heating equipment must be installed with proper clearances from combustible materials and with proper ventilation.
Take care when using temporary enclosures. Temporary enclosures should be made with flame-resistant tarpaulins or materials with low flammability.
Foam Plastic
Many types of foam plastic used for insulation are extremely combustible. Welding and cutting should not be allowed near foam plastics. Foam plastic materials should be sheathed with fire-resistant materials as soon as possible to reduce the exposure.
Smoking
Construction managers, general contractors, and subcontractors should enforce stringent smoking controls. Smoking should be prohibited during the demolition as well as during other hazardous construction phases.
If smoking is permitted, designated smoking areas should be created. Combustibles should be removed from designated smoking areas. Proper containers for cigarette extinguishment should be provided. No Smoking signs should be posted in areas where smoking is prohibited.
Unauthorized Access
During building construction and renovation, lack of security can increase the potential for unauthorized people to access the building site. These people can cause vandalism or start a fire (intentionally or unintentionally). Having proper lighting, fencing and periodic security patrols can help reduce this risk.
